Natasha Shirazi (born 8 February 1996) is a Ugandan footballer with Danish citizenship, who plays as a forward for Turkish the Istanbul -basedclub Beşiktaş J.K. and the Uganda women's national team.

Shirazi has played for BSF, B 93 and Nordsjælland in Denmark, for Rayo Vallecano and La Solana in Spain and for Maccabi Kishronot Hadera in Israel.[1][2]
In August 2022, Shirazi moved to Turkey and joined Beşiktaş J.K. in Istanbul to play in the 2022-23 Super League.[3][4]
Shirazi played for Uganda at senior level on 3 July 2016 in a 0–4 friendly away loss to Kenya.[5]
Shirazi also holds Danish citizenship.[6]
